How can I prepare my home for fluctuating spring temps?

Be certain your home is ready for spring temperature swings by replacing or repairing faulty parts of your home and hardscaping. On the outside of your house, examine roof shingles or metal roofs for rust or damage that could let water leak inside. Keep gutters functional and clear to prevent ice dams if you're still prone to winter weather. Chimney caps and vinyl siding should be swapped out if they're in poor condition. Also, check cinder blocks and bricks for cracks, and ensure indoor ceiling tiles are free from water damage and missing pieces. If moisture freezes inside the cracks, you might be dealing with damage.

Should I get an inverter generator or a portable generator?

Restore electricity in your home even after severe weather takes it out. We've got the options you need when searching for a generator for sale. Inverter generators are cleaner and quieter than traditional portable generators. They'll adjust to the required load, making less noise when they create less power. When browsing generators, keep in mind that portable generators cost less and generate more electricity than inverter generators, but they're louder and heavier. Always run your generators outdoors, away from windows and doors, for safety purposes.

What are the benefits of doorbell cameras?

Enjoy safety, peace of mind, and privacy with a wired or wireless doorbell camera. Stop peeking through an adjacent window when you can watch human or animal visitors in real time. Some doorbell cams even let you speak to whoever is at the door via your phone, a useful interaction to scare off potential porch pirates or talk to delivery people. Several cameras integrate with your smart home app or hub to give you easy and flexible accessibility. Save video clips for future reference as it suits you.
